A CAGR of 8.8% is being recorded over the forecast period (2027-2033), underscoring the market’s structurally resilient growth trajectory Global Catalytic Activated Carbon Market Definition The catalytic activated carbon market refers to the commercial ecosystem centered on the production, distribution, and application of activated carbon materials engineered with catalytic properties to promote chemical reactions and pollutant breakdown. This market covers carbon products designed for high surface area, controlled pore structure, and surface functionalization, enabling effective removal and conversion of contaminants across gas and liquid treatment processes. Key product categories include impregnated activated carbon, metal-doped carbon catalysts, and specialty grades used in emission control, water purification, chemical processing, and energy applications. Market growth is supported by increasing adoption of catalytic activated carbon in industrial air pollution control, particularly for mercury removal, NOx reduction, and VOC treatment across power plants, cement facilities, and waste incinerators. Tighter environmental norms are driving upgrades in flue gas and wastewater treatment systems, sustaining regular demand. Rising wastewater treatment investments and growing use in chemical processing and energy applications are further supporting steady market expansion through long-term contracts and project-based supply models. Global Catalytic Activated Carbon Market Drivers The market drivers for the catalytic activated carbon market can be influenced by various factors. These may include: Demand from Environmental Remediation Applications: Strong demand from environmental remediation applications is driving the catalytic activated carbon market, as stricter air and water quality regulations are pushing industries to adopt effective pollutant removal solutions. Catalytic activated carbon is increasingly used for VOC control, mercury removal, and treatment of industrial wastewater due to its dual adsorption and catalytic oxidation capability. Expansion of pollution control projects across power generation, manufacturing, and municipal utilities is supporting steady consumption. Long-term compliance requirements are encouraging continuous replacement and recurring demand. Utilization across Industrial Emission Control Systems: Rising utilization across industrial emission control systems is supporting market growth, as industries seek reliable materials for flue gas treatment and odor control. Catalytic activated carbon is gaining preference in chemical processing, cement, and waste incineration facilities due to its ability to operate efficiently under varying temperature and contaminant loads. Increased retrofitting of existing plants with emission reduction units is reinforcing adoption. Focus on stable operational performance supports sustained procurement. Adoption in Water Treatment and Purification Processes: Increasing adoption in water treatment and purification processes is stimulating market momentum, as industries and municipalities address contaminants such as organic compounds, chlorine by-products, and trace pollutants. Catalytic activated carbon supports improved treatment efficiency and longer service life compared to conventional carbon. Expansion of desalination plants, industrial water recycling, and drinking water infrastructure is reinforcing volume demand. Emphasis on consistent treatment outcomes supports repeat usage. Expansion of Global Industrial and Energy Infrastructure: Ongoing expansion of global industrial and energy infrastructure is supporting catalytic activated carbon market growth, as new facilities integrate pollution control materials at the design stage. Growth in thermal power plants, oil and gas processing units, and large-scale manufacturing hubs is strengthening regional demand. Supply chain diversification and localized production agreements are improving material availability. Long-term supply contracts with industrial operators are enhancing demand stability and market visibility. Global Catalytic Activated Carbon Market Restraints Several factors act as restraints or challenges for the catalytic activated carbon market. These may include: Volatility in Raw Material Supply: Volatility in raw material supply is restraining the catalytic activated carbon market, as dependence on coconut shells, coal, wood, and petroleum-based precursors exposes manufacturers to supply disruptions. Seasonal availability, price swings, and sourcing concentration in specific regions create uncertainty in procurement planning. Variability in precursor quality also affects activation efficiency and final product performance. Manufacturers operating in import-dependent regions face added risk from logistics delays and trade-related constraints, limiting consistent production output. Stringent Environmental and Regulatory Compliance: Stringent environmental and regulatory compliance requirements are constraining market expansion, as production and activation processes must meet strict emission, waste disposal, and workplace safety norms. Compliance obligations raise documentation, monitoring, and certification costs across manufacturing and distribution stages. Approval timelines for use in air purification, water treatment, and industrial emission control applications can delay project execution. Differences in regulatory frameworks across regions further complicate global supply chains and market entry planning. High Production and Regeneration Costs: High production and regeneration costs are limiting broader adoption of catalytic activated carbon, as thermal activation, chemical treatment, and surface modification processes are energy-intensive. Specialized equipment and controlled operating conditions increase capital and operating expenses. Regeneration cycles add further cost, particularly in applications requiring frequent replacement or reactivation. Cost-sensitive end users, especially in developing markets, often evaluate alternative filtration or catalyst materials under ongoing pricing pressure. Limited Awareness and Technical Understanding in Emerging Applications: Limited awareness and technical understanding in emerging application areas are slowing demand growth, as many end users remain unfamiliar with the performance benefits of catalytic activated carbon over conventional grades. Insufficient technical outreach and application-specific data restrict adoption in sectors such as indoor air quality management, niche industrial gas treatment, and advanced wastewater treatment. Conservative procurement practices lead to hesitation in switching from established materials. As a result, penetration in newer industrial segments and developing regions continues at a gradual pace. Global Catalytic Activated Carbon Market Segmentation Analysis The Global Catalytic Activated Carbon Market is segmented based on Product Type, Application, End-User, and Geography. Catalytic Activated Carbon Market, By Product Type Powdered Activated Carbon (PAC): Powdered activated carbon holds steady demand, as its fine particle size supports rapid adsorption and effective contaminant removal in liquid-phase applications. Widespread usage in batch treatment systems and polishing stages of water treatment plants supports consistent consumption volumes. Ease of dosing and compatibility with existing treatment setups encourage continued use. Demand from municipal and industrial water treatment facilities sustains this segment. Granular Activated Carbon (GAC): Granular activated carbon is witnessing strong growth, driven by its suitability for continuous flow systems and longer service life. Preference for fixed-bed reactors and reusable filtration units supports adoption across water and air treatment applications. Regeneration capability and lower operating costs compared to powdered formats increase acceptance among end users. Expanding infrastructure for drinking water and wastewater treatment supports segment expansion. Extruded Activated Carbon (EAC): Extruded activated carbon is dominating performance-focused applications, as its uniform shape, low pressure drop, and high mechanical strength support efficient gas-phase treatment. Increasing use in air purification, industrial emission control, and catalytic processes drives demand. Superior handling properties and reduced dust formation support operational reliability. Growth in industrial air treatment installations reinforces segment share. Catalytic Activated Carbon Market, By Application Water Treatment: Water treatment represents the largest application segment, as catalytic activated carbon is widely used for removal of chlorine, chloramines, organic compounds, and odor-causing substances. Rising investments in municipal water infrastructure and stricter water quality standards support sustained demand. Adoption in point-of-use and point-of-entry systems further raises consumption volumes. Industrial wastewater treatment requirements strengthen long-term application demand. Air Purification: Air purification is witnessing substantial growth, driven by rising concerns around indoor air quality and industrial emissions. Use of catalytic activated carbon in HVAC systems, air scrubbers, and emission control units supports expansion. Increasing installation of air treatment systems in commercial buildings and manufacturing facilities raises product uptake. Regulatory pressure on air pollution control supports ongoing application growth. Industrial Processes: Industrial processes show steady expansion, as catalytic activated carbon is used in gas purification, solvent recovery, and chemical processing. Demand from petrochemical, power generation, and manufacturing sectors supports consistent usage. Ability to handle high contaminant loads and withstand harsh operating conditions encourages adoption. Process efficiency requirements sustain long-term industrial demand. Pharmaceuticals: Pharmaceutical applications are growing at a measured pace, as activated carbon is used in purification, decolorization, and impurity removal during drug manufacturing. Strict quality standards support demand for high-purity carbon grades. Expansion of pharmaceutical production capacity supports gradual volume growth. Consistency and reliability requirements maintain steady consumption.
